Complaint #1799237 submitted on 02/23/2016 relating to Experian. Complaint relates to Credit reporting - Incorrect information on credit report Reinserted previously deleted info.

Complaint was submitted via Web and sent to the company on Tuesday 23rd February 2016.

Narrative (may be redacted).

I have worked extremely hard to improve my credit ; however, it appears as though my efforts are in vain. Everyone hits a rough patch in life and I 've definitely had my share but I worked tirelessly to repair my credit. I made tough sacrifices but it seems as though I can not get ahead. My co-worker filed bankruptcy a few years ago and has a better credit score than me. I could have done the same but eventually someone stills pay for that " free get out of jail '' card. She just refinanced on her existing home with a lower interest rate because of her great credit score. In the XXXX XXXX of last year my credit score was over XXXX with many outstanding debt. I began to pay them down and focus on home ownership. Since I 've paid down most and been current on my debt I ca n't get my score over XXXX. A loan officer pulled my credit a couple days ago and here 's what it had to say : Serious delinquencies and public record or collection filed, too many inquiries last 12 months, Time since delinquency is too recent or unknown. Now to the credit of the bureaus I do have XXXX liens in which one was released. However, it 's the same information that 's been on my report for several years. The one that 's released has not been removed from my credit reports. To add insult to the injury I tried calling the bureaus. Have you tried lately??? It 's a joke!!! Credit Bureaus and Credit Reporting Agencies rank in what the top XXXX % of complaints yet they go unmonitored and unaccountable for information they report. My goal in life is to lend, not borrow and owe no man nothing! I hope the person reading my email do n't take offense. I 'm frustrated and disappointed that I 'm penalized because I tried to do the right thing by paying my debts. If I filed bankruptcy I would be in a better position. My co-worker is just one of many stories I 've heard. The message of it 's better to bankrupt than to pay up is being heard across America. Will someone take a stand and make these agencies be more accountable for the information they report and more accessible to the pubic?
